The Strategic Imperative for Executive Inventory Oversight
In the distribution sector, inventory is not merely a stockpile; it is a significant portion of working capital and a primary driver of customer satisfaction. For C-suite executives, the challenge is not a lack of data, but the inability to synthesize disparate operational metrics into a coherent strategic view. Distribution ERP reporting intelligence bridges this gap by transforming transactional data from order management, warehouse operations, and finance into actionable insights. This intelligence allows leaders to move beyond reactive firefighting to proactive strategic planning, ensuring that inventory levels align with demand forecasts, financial constraints, and service level agreements.
Traditional reporting often silos data within specific departments, leading to fragmented views of performance. An integrated ERP reporting architecture consolidates these silos, providing a single source of truth. This unified view is critical for executive oversight, as it enables the correlation of operational metrics with financial outcomes. For instance, understanding the impact of a warehouse bottleneck on cash flow requires linking operational data with financial ledgers. Without this integration, executives may make decisions based on incomplete information, leading to suboptimal inventory levels, increased carrying costs, or stockouts that erode market share.

Data Integration and Master Data Governance
Data quality is the cornerstone of reliable reporting. Master data governance ensures that product, customer, and supplier data are consistent across all systems. In distribution, product data accuracy is particularly critical, as discrepancies in unit of measure, cost, or location can lead to significant financial errors. Implementing strict data validation rules and automated cleansing processes within the ERP helps maintain data integrity. Furthermore, integrating external data sources, such as supplier lead times or market demand signals, enhances the predictive capabilities of reporting intelligence.

Key Metrics for Executive Inventory Performance
Executive oversight requires a focus on high-level KPIs that directly impact business performance. These metrics should be selected based on their relevance to strategic goals and their ability to provide actionable insights. The following table outlines key metrics and their strategic significance.
| Metric | Definition | Strategic Significance |
|---|---|---|
| Inventory Turnover Ratio | Cost of Goods Sold / Average Inventory | Indicates how efficiently inventory is being sold and replaced. Low turnover suggests overstocking or obsolescence. |
| Days Sales of Inventory (DSI) | Average Inventory / (COGS / 365) | Measures the average number of days it takes to sell inventory. Critical for cash flow management. |
| Stockout Rate | Number of Stockouts / Total Demand | Reflects service level performance and potential revenue loss due to unmet demand. |
| Inventory Carrying Cost | Storage, Insurance, Obsolescence, and Capital Costs | Quantifies the total cost of holding inventory. Essential for optimizing stock levels. |
| Fill Rate | Units Fulfilled / Units Requested | Measures the ability to meet customer demand from available stock. Directly impacts customer satisfaction. |
Beyond these core metrics, executives should monitor trend lines and variance analysis to identify emerging issues. For example, a gradual increase in DSI may indicate a shift in demand patterns or a breakdown in replenishment processes. By drilling down into specific product categories or distribution centers, leaders can pinpoint the root causes of performance deviations and implement targeted corrective actions.

Procurement and Supplier Coordination
Procurement data is crucial for understanding the lead times and reliability of suppliers. Reporting on supplier performance, such as on-time delivery rates and quality scores, helps executives assess the risk of supply disruptions. Additionally, analyzing purchase order aging can reveal delays in the procurement process that may impact inventory availability. By correlating procurement data with inventory levels, leaders can optimize safety stock levels and negotiate better terms with suppliers.
Transportation and Logistics Performance
Transportation costs and performance significantly impact the total cost of distribution. Reporting on transportation metrics, such as cost per unit, transit times, and carrier performance, provides insights into logistics efficiency. By analyzing these metrics in conjunction with inventory data, executives can evaluate the trade-offs between holding more inventory to reduce transportation frequency and the associated carrying costs. This analysis supports decisions on network design and carrier selection.
Financial Integration and Cost Optimization
One of the primary advantages of ERP reporting intelligence is the seamless integration of operational data with financial ledgers. This integration allows for accurate cost allocation and profitability analysis at the product, customer, and channel level. For distribution companies, understanding the true cost of serving each customer segment is critical for pricing strategies and resource allocation.
By linking inventory movements to financial transactions, ERP systems can provide real-time visibility into the impact of inventory decisions on cash flow and profitability. For example, a report on inventory aging can highlight the financial risk of obsolete stock, enabling executives to make timely decisions on markdowns or liquidation. Similarly, analyzing the cost of goods sold in relation to inventory levels can reveal opportunities for cost reduction through improved procurement or production planning.
